A Comprehensive Guide to Prams and Pushchairs in the UK

When it comes to inviting a brand-new member to the household, the right gear can make a world of difference. For brand-new parents in the UK, picking between a pram and a pushchair can be a difficult job. This helpful guide will stroll you through the distinctions between prams and pushchairs, the numerous types readily available, crucial functions to think about, and a convenient FAQ area to respond to typical inquiries.

Comprehending Prams and Pushchairs

Prams

prams pushchairs, typically described as "baby carriages," are designed mostly for infants. They normally include a flat, reclining seat that permits newborns to lie down in a comfy position. This makes them ideal for babies from birth till they reach around 6 months when they can sit upright.

Pushchairs

Pushchairs, on the other hand, are more versatile and are developed for a little older babies and young children. They normally have a more upright seating position and are meant for kids who can sit up on their own. Pushchairs frequently include additional features like adjustable seats and canopies, making them ideal for various parenting requirements.

FeaturePramsPushchairs
Age RangeNewborn to 6 months6 months to toddler
Seating PositionFully recliningUpright
PortabilityNormally heavierNormally lighter
Weight LimitVaries (approximately 15 kg)Varies (approximately 25 kg)
AccessoriesLimitedMore adjustable

Kinds of Prams and Pushchairs

When searching for sale prams and pushchairs, it's necessary to understand the different types available:

1. Requirement Prams/Pushchairs:

  • Description: Basic models typically include rear-facing or forward-facing seats. They are a great choice for parents who want something simple and functional.
  • Ideal For: Families trying to find an economical option for day-to-day use.

2. Travel Systems:

  • Description: A combination of a vehicle seat and a pushchair, often offered as a plan. Travel systems allow easy shift from vehicle to pram without interrupting the baby.
  • Perfect For: Parents who often travel or need a versatile, all-in-one option.

3. Convertible Prams/Pushchairs:

  • Description: These designs can transform from a pram shops near me for babies to a pushchair for older kids. They generally allow for different configurations.
  • Perfect For: Growing families desiring a long-term financial investment.

4. Umbrella Strollers:

  • Description: Lightweight and compact pushchairs that can be folded quickly. No frills but extremely portable.
  • Ideal For: Parents on the go searching for a convenient option for quick trips.

5. All-Terrain Strollers:

  • Description: Strollers developed for rough terrain, frequently including large wheels and tough frames.
  • Perfect For: Active households who take pleasure in outside experiences and require a robust stroller.
TypeProsCons
StandardBudget-friendly, functionalLess functions, may not be as flexible
Travel SystemConvenient, no need to wake the babyCan be bulkier
ConvertibleLong-term financial investment, flexibleNormally more expensive
Umbrella StrollerLightweight, highly portableLimited functions and comfort
All-Terrain StrollerGreat for outdoors, resilientCan be much heavier and more expensive

Secret Features to Consider

Picking the right pram or pushchair includes evaluating several important aspects:

1. Security Features:

  • Look for 5-point harness systems, trusted brakes, and sturdy frames. Constantly check safety certifications.

2. Convenience:

  • A cushioned seat, adjustable canopy, and suspension systems can improve your baby's comfort throughout walks.

3. Relieve of Use:

  • Consider the weight, folding system, and maneuverability of the pram or pushchair. Functions like swivel wheels make navigation much easier.

4. Storage Space:

  • Check for under-seat storage baskets and additional compartments for bring fundamentals like diapers, treats, and toys.

5. Longevity:

  • Look for models that can adjust as your child grows or that can be utilized for multiple kids in the household.

Frequently asked questions About Prams and Pushchairs

1. What is the distinction in between a pram and a pushchair?

Prams are designed for newborns with a flat, reclining seat, while pushchairs are intended for older babies and toddlers with an upright seating position.

2. When should I transition from a pram to a pushchair?

A lot of parents shift when their baby can stay up on their own, normally around 6 months of age.

3. Are travel systems worth the financial investment?

Travel systems can be more hassle-free if you drive regularly, as they enable simple transitions in between the cars and truck and stroller.

4. What is the best kind of stroller for city living?

A lightweight umbrella stroller or a compact travel system may be best for navigating hectic streets and public transport.

5. How do I maintain my pram or pushchair?

Regularly examine for any loose parts, clean the material and wheels, and store it in a dry place to lengthen its life-span.
